🃏 My $6 Poker Challenge

Today I’m starting a new experiment with poker discipline, bankroll growth, and consistency. The idea is simple: begin every day with just $6 and see how far I can take it by playing structured sessions.

📌 Rules of the Challenge

Starting Bankroll: $6 per day.

Table Selection: Always sit at the minimum buy-in table for $1.50.

Level Up Rule: Each time I build my stack to at least the minimum buy-in of the next level, I move up.

Example: $1.50 table → once I reach $3 (or whatever the next minimum is), I sit at that higher table.

Time Control: Play 1 hour maximum per session.

Sessions: 4 times a day — morning, midday, evening, and late night.

Tracking: At the end of each session, record profit/loss and current bankroll.

🎯 Goal

This isn’t about getting rich quick. It’s about learning discipline, bankroll management, and pressure handling. Starting small, respecting limits, and stepping up only when the bankroll allows.

📊 Daily Structure

Session 1 (Morning): Sit with $1.50, play 1 hour.

Session 2 (Midday): Same rules.

Session 3 (Evening): Same rules.

Session 4 (Late Night): Same rules.

End of Day Recap: Add up results, see where I stand, and reset for tomorrow with $6.

🧠 What I Expect to Learn

Patience with small blinds and small wins.

Handling swings without going on tilt.

Building confidence as the bankroll naturally grows.

Respecting a stop-loss and reset strategy.
